Responsibilities
- Partner with Account Executives across the full sales cycle on Enterprise and Strategic opportunities - participating actively in discovery, not just demos.
- Prepare and deliver compelling, story-driven product demonstrations tailored to each prospect's practice area and buying committee.
- Partner with internal teams such as sales engineers, sales, marketing, product, etc. to develop accurate talk tracks, demo flows, and use cases for product launches and campaigns - providing real-world, field-tested input that marketing collateral can anchor against.
- Support the Sales team - delivering product demos, producing video and live-demo content for partner referral programs, contributing to RFP responses, and representing Filevine at partner conferences and on-sites, etc.
- Build and maintain demo environments used for events or sales cycles.
- Partner with Product Management and Product Marketing on pre-launch enablement so AEs and SEs share a common anchor narrative before a release hits the market.
- Support the development and delivery of internal sales certifications and training programs that keep the field current on Filevine's rapidly evolving product portfolio.
- You will partner closely with Account Executives to position Filevine's case management, AI, and contract management solutions to large law firms, insurance carriers, government entities, and corporate legal departments.

- Travel & Location
- This role carries a weekly travel expectation. Filevine is currently fielding one to three Enterprise/Strategic on-site requests per week, and this position exists to meet sophisticated buyers where they are - in their offices, at conferences, and at executive meetings. The possibility of weekly travel should be an expectation.
- Salt Lake City is the preferred base for close collaboration with sales leadership, executives, and the broader SE team - however, remote work is acceptable for this niche role.
